National Stock Number 5905-00-597-0856

National Stock Number (NSN) 5905-00-597-0856, or NIIN 005970856, (resistor,fixed,wire wound) was assigned January 11, 1975 in the Federal Logistics Information System (FLIS). NIIN 005970856 was cancelled on August 29, 2018, with a cancelled status of "Item is Cancelled - Inactive." There is no known replacement specified for this stock number. This NSN does not replace any other NSNs.

There are no manufacturer part numbers associated to this NSN.

This part number has not been procured by the US Government in over 5 years.

This NSN is assigned to Item Name Code (INC) 00010. [A RESISTOR WHOSE OHMIC VALUE CANNOT BE ADJUSTED OR VARIED. THE RESISTANCE ELEMENT CONSISTS OF HIGH RESISTANCE WIRE (OR RIBBON) EITHER WOUND ON AN INSULATED FORM OR CONSTRUCTED SO AS TO BE SELF SUPPORTING. OPPOSITION TO THE FLOW OF CURRENT IS AN INHERENT PROPERTY OF THE RESISTANCE WIRE AND IS MANIFEST BY THE HEAT DISSIPATION IN THE RESISTOR. EXCLUDES:SUPPRESSOR,IGNITION INTERFERENCE.].
